What is the difference between Assistant Webgl vs Webgl Developer?
| Aspect | Assistant Webgl | Webgl Developer |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Basic understanding of WebGL, often an entry-level or supporting role | Advanced knowledge of WebGL, programming skills, often a degree in computer science or related field |
| Work Environment | Supportive role, assisting in projects, often in team settings | Lead or core development role, designing and implementing WebGL graphics |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in tech companies, startups, and multimedia projects for support tasks | Used in game development, 3D visualization, and interactive media projects |
The main difference between Assistant Webgl and Webgl Developer lies in their experience level, responsibilities, and expertise. Assistant Webgl roles focus on supporting tasks with basic WebGL knowledge, while Webgl Developers are responsible for creating complex graphics and applications, requiring advanced skills and experience.
